Method
Preparation
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large bowl, whisk together gochujang, olive oil, soy sauce, honey, sesame oil, salt, and pepper.
- Add the broccoli florets to the bowl and toss until they are well coated in the gochujang mixture.
- Spread the broccoli onto a baking sheet in a single layer.
Cooking
- Roast in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the edges are crispy and the broccoli is tender.
Serving
- Remove from the oven, sprinkle with sesame seeds, and serve hot as a side dish.
Notes
Adjust the spice level of the gochujang based on your preference. For extra texture, consider adding chopped nuts or different seeds as a topping.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container for 3-4 days or frozen for up to 2 months.
